摘要: The objective of this study was to optimize the utilization of deposited fat in Sunit sheep, with a focus on dietary nutrition. This study also elucidated variations in lipid metabolism among subcutaneous fat (SF), perirenal fat (PF), and tail fat (TF) in sheep of different ages using non-targeted lipidomic techniques. In total, 173 different lipids were identified, of which triacylglycerol (TG) and phosphatidylcholine (PC) were prominent. The relative intensity of TG was highest at 6 months of age in three adipose depots. Glycerophospholipids (PLs) were expressed at peak levels in TF and SF at 18 months of age. Pathway analysis revealed that biosynthesis of unsaturated fatty acids, linoleic acid metabolism, glycerophospholipid metabolism, and fatty acid biosynthesis were the main pathways involved in the metabolism of adipose depots. These findings provide a comprehensive reference for the metabolic characteristics and pathways of adipose tissue in sheep and the utilization of its byproducts.
